Comprehending Tilt and Turn Windows
Tilt and turn windows are created with a distinct mechanism that allows users to open the window in two ways: tilting it inward for ventilation or totally turning it open for optimal gain access to. This dual functionality makes them an appealing option for many property owners. However, the complex equipment involved can sometimes result in repair requirements.

Step 1: Inspect the Window
Before beginning any repair, carry out a thorough inspection of the window. Look for the following:
Alignment and functionality of the hingesCondition of the weather condition removingPerformance of deals withAny damage to the glass or frameStep 2: Address Sticking MechanismsClean the Hinges: Use a soft brush or vacuum to get rid of dirt and debris. Use a silicone-based lubricant to make sure smooth motion.Realign the Window: If the window is misaligned, change the hinges according to the manufacturer's instructions.Action 3: Replace Weather StrippingGet Rid Of Old Stripping: Gently pry off the worn weather condition removing.Cut New Stripping: Measure and cut the brand-new weather removing to size.Set Up New Stripping: Press the brand-new removing into location, ensuring a tight seal.Step 4: Fix or Replace HandlesTighten Up Loose Handles: Use a screwdriver to tighten up any loose screws.Change Broken Handles: Follow the producer's directions to eliminate the old handle and install a new one.Step 5: Repair Glass IssuesLittle Cracks: Use a glass repair package to fill in small fractures following the kit guidelines.Replacement: For larger cracks or damage, think about working with a professional glazier to change the glass.When to Call a Professional

Regular maintenance, such as cleaning and lubrication of the hardware, should be done a minimum of once a year. Weather condition stripping might require changing every few years.
Q2: Can I replace the whole window myself?
Replacing an entire window can be complicated and usually needs professional installation to guarantee appropriate sealing and insulation.
Q3: What kind of lubricant should I use?
A silicone-based lube is suggested for the systems of tilt and turn windows, as it will not attract dirt or dust.
Q4: How can I enhance the energy effectiveness of my tilt and turn windows?
Regularly examine and replace weather condition stripping, make sure hinges are clean and working, and think about setting up thermal drapes or blinds.
Q5: Is it worth repairing older tilt and turn windows?
If the structure and mechanism are sound, it may be more affordable to repair than to replace, especially if they offer great energy effectiveness and aesthetic appeals.
